dc.description.abstractSystematic observation of debris flow was carried out at valley Kamikamihori on the easternslope of Mt. Yakedake in 1979. A synthetic observation system equipped with many instru-mentations was set in operation which had been devised and put to practical use in these ten years.In the source area, topographic changes of slopes were surveyed besides the hydrologicalobservations. In the channel reach, measurements were frequently carried out to reveal thegeomorphological processes in the valley bed, besides the observation of flowing state of debrisflow by the system.Special effort was made to study the depositional process of the debris flows. In order toreveal the dynamical aspects of debris flow in flowing, retarding and stopping stages, many typesof visual recording systems were set in the whole area of the fan. For the investigation of thedepositional features, leveling survey and polar coordinate survey have been frequently carriedout before and after debris flows.With heavy rainfalls, this year, seven debris flows occurred, among which the one on Aug.22 was the largest in the last ten years. Following items are discussed on the basis of observedfacts; (a) relationship between rainfall intensity and runoff at the time when debris flow occurrs, (b) exact calculation of gully runoff by the kinematic-wave method, ? violent erosion in therill and gully, (d) strength and frequency characteristics of ground vibration due to debris flows, (e) lateral inclination of the head part of debris flow, (f) seasonal changes in the valley profile, (g) dependence of debris accumulation behind the dams on the individual scale of debris flow, (h) arrival of a large debris flow to gentle slope with an inclination of 1-2°, (I) development ofthe fan due to the repeated deposition of debris lobes, (j) erosional and depositional effects bydebris flow and sand flow over the fan, (k) a low infiltration loss of water in the debris flow atthe fan.en
